Is Twyford a private school?
Twyford is a private school, and a registered charity. It accepts both day pupils and boarders, and has a pre-preparatory school on the same campus for children below the age of five.

How do I find the best primary school for my child?
However, it can be useful to think about:
- National test results. Each year, children in Year 2 (7-years-old) and Year 6 (11-years-old) sit assessments in reading, writing, mathematics and grammar, punctuation and spelling.
- Ofsted rating.
- Reputation.
- The school’s website.
- Visits to the school.
